Nurse Aid (NA)-Horizon Assisted Living

Part Time Night Shift- 6p-6a

POSITION DESCRIPTION:

Nurse Aid (NA) provides services to residents in accordance with care plans, facility policies, and procedures and at the direction of supervisor(s).

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• None

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Maintains established Horizon policies and procedures, objectives, performance improvement program, safety, environmental and infection control standards, and protocols.
  • Maintains a clean, safe, comfortable, and therapeutic environment for residents and families per Horizon standards.
  • Provides general aspects of care that meet psychosocial or physical needs or both simultaneously, within the nursing assistant’s scope of practice.
  • Meets communication needs of residents.
  • Treats residents and their families with respect and dignity. Identifies and addresses psychosocial, cultural, ethnic, and religious/spiritual needs of patients and family.
  • Demonstrates performance reflecting the initiative and responsibility expected of a nursing assistant.
  • Helps in admission, transfer, and discharge of residents.
  • Able to communicate effectively in English, both verbally and in writing.
  • Maintains confidentiality of protected health information, including verbal, written, and electronic communications.
  • Help with orientation of new employees.
  • Use proper lifting and body mechanics while delivering care to residents and meet the physical demands of the position.
  • Reports changes in a resident’s condition to nurse and/or supervisor.
  • Maintains a working knowledge of all equipment used in treatment of residents.
  • Maintains and replaces supplies on unit assigned.
  • As a condition of employment, completes all assigned training and skills competency.
  • Performs other duties as assigned, within the Nursing Assistant’s scope of practice.

Physical Requirements:

  • Physically demanding, high-stress environment
  • Exposure to blood and body fluids, communicable diseases, chemicals, radiation, and repetitive motions
  • Standing and walking for extensive periods of time
  • Ability to help in evacuation of residents during emergency situations.
  • Ability to bend, stoop, kneel, crouch, perform overhead lifting and perform other common physical movements as needed for the position.
  • Dexterity of hands and fingers to perform patient care.
  • Ability to lift, move, push, or pull a minimum of thirty-five pounds. 
  • May be subject to falls, burns from equipment, and/or odors throughout the day, encounter reactions from dust, tobacco smoke, disinfectants, and other air contaminants.
  • Subject to exposure to infectious waste, diseases and/or conditions which include AIDS, Coronavirus, Hepatitis B, and Tuberculosis.
  • Must be able to move intermittently throughout the workday.
  • Working irregular hours including after hours
Qualifications:

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Ability to read, write, speak, and understand the English language.
  • Must be a supportive team member, contribute to and be an example of teamwork.
  • Ability to make independent decisions when circumstances call for such action.
  • Ability to deal tactfully with personnel, patients, family members, visitors, government agencies/personnel, and the public.
  • Must be able to relay information concerning a patient’s condition.
  • May be subject to hostile or emotional patients, family members, visitors, or personnel.
  • Must have leadership, supervisory ability, and willingness to work harmoniously with and supervise other personnel.
  • Must be able to follow oral and written instructions.
  • Communicates with medical and nursing staff, and other departments.
  • Subject to call-back during emergency conditions.
  • Basic computer skills, including ability to navigate electronic medical record systems.
  • Subject to frequent interruptions.
  • May work beyond normal working hours and on weekends holidays when necessary.
  • In-depth knowledge of long-term care practices and protocols.
  • Must be able to pass a background check and drug screening.

Education/Experience:

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• 1-year prior experience in SNF/Assisted Living preferred but not needed.

Licenses/Certifications:

  • Registered as an Unlicensed Assistant Personnel (UAP) or completion within three (3) months of hire.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required or willing to obtain.
